The Role of Family Education in Forming Children's Morals in Adiwarno Village, Batanghari District, East Lampung Regency Nur Aini; Siti Roudhatul Jannah; M. Kharis Fadillah

Abstract

Children are a gift that has been given by Allah Swt to every family, with the presence of a child in the midst of the family adds happiness to every parent, with the presence of a child all parents definitely want their children to become pious children, to create all that parents should provide appropriate education to their children at their age of development. Because the first and foremost education obtained by a child is from family education. The importance of education in this family means that every parent should be able to understand what kind of education should be taught to children so that they can form good morals, which can produce a pious and pious generation. However, there are still parents who do not care about their children, both in terms of attitude and speech. This study is a descriptive qualitative study, the subjects of the study were children aged 7-12 years, while the informants of this study were parents, children and neighbors or people who were considered to know about the child's personality. The methods used in this study were observation, interviews and documentation. To check the validity of the data using data triangulation. After conducting research on family education in the formation of children's morals in Adiwarno Village, Batanghari District, East Lampung Regency, namely by providing examples, advice and understanding, direction, and habituation. And the teachings given about morals are religious education, such as providing learning about monotheism, politeness, speech, instilling good things in children. When educating, parents prioritize affection so that children can accept the teachings given to them.

Character Education Through Al-Barzanji: A Study of Traditional Muslim Society in Tanjung Harapan Village, Seputih Banyak, Central Lampung Athoillah, Athoillah; Siti Roudhatul Jannah; M. Sayyidul Abrori

Abstract

This study aims to examine the contribution of the Al-Barzanji reading tradition in shaping the character of traditional Muslim society in Tanjung Harapan Village, Seputih Banyak, Central Lampung. The problem raised in this study is how character values ​​such as deliberation, justice, compassion, and forgiveness are applied through the Al-Barzanji tradition and the challenges faced in integrating this tradition into people's lives. This study uses a qualitative method with a descriptive approach. The subjects of the study consisted of village heads, religious figures, people who are active in the Al-Barzanji tradition, and the younger generation in Tanjung Harapan Village. Data collection was carried out through observation, in-depth interviews, and documentation related to Al-Barzanji reading activities. Data validity testing was carried out through triangulation techniques by comparing the results of observations, interviews, and documentation. Data analysis techniques include data collection, data reduction, data presentation, and drawing conclusions. The results of the study indicate that the Al-Barzanji reading tradition still takes place in Tanjung Harapan Village and has an important role in instilling character values ​​in the community. The value of deliberation is reflected in the habit of deliberation before religious activities, the value of justice is seen in the attitude of mutual respect between citizens, compassion is manifested in harmonious social relations, and the attitude of forgiveness is practiced in everyday life. However, the challenges faced are the low interest of the younger generation in this tradition and the limited understanding of the community regarding the essence of character education in Al-Barzanji. Therefore, an innovative strategy is needed to maintain and develop this tradition as an effective medium for character education.
